Job Summary: The Banquet Captain is responsible for overseeing the setup, service, and breakdown of banquet events to ensure a high level of guest satisfaction. This role works closely with the Manager to coordinate banquet operations, supervise staff, and maintain service standards for all events.

Essential Functions and Duties:

  • Provide professional and courteous service at all times during banquet events.
  • Ensure timely and efficient setup of all function rooms in accordance with event specifications.
  • Maintain inventory levels of banquet supplies and equipment.
  • Supervise and direct banquet servers, bartenders, and house-persons to ensure consistent service.
  • Work with the Banquet Manager to manage event schedules and last-minute changes.
  • Ensure proper cleaning and storage of all banquet equipment after events.
  • Coordinate with clients during events to ensure satisfaction and address any concerns.
  • Assist in setting up function rooms according to client and event requirements.
  • Collaborate with the kitchen and other departments to ensure smooth service flow during events.
  • Conduct pre-event meetings to communicate event details to staff.

Required Experience, Education, and Skills:

  • 2+ years of experience in banquet or event management, preferably in a supervisory role.
  • Strong leadership and commun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ple events simultaneously and make adjustments as needed.
  • Knowledge of banquet setups, service standards, and health/safety regulations.
  • Proficiency in using point-of-sale systems and event management software.
  • Ability to work well under pressure and maintain a positive attitude in high-paced environments.

Work Environment:

  • Primarily an indoor work environment with protection from weather conditions but not necessarily from temperature changes.
  • Frequent standing, walking, and lifting +/-40 lbs.
  • Requires walking and standing for extended periods, with occasional lifting and handling of event equipment.
  • Must be available to work flexible shifts, including nights, weekends, and holidays.
